MTV VMAs 2018: Camila wins top honours, Madonna pays tribute to Franklin

“Havana” hitmaker Camila Cabello won the Moon Man trophies for artist of the year and video of the year for the song here at the MTV Video Music Awards (VMAs), where Jennifer Lopez won the coveted Michael Jackson Vanguard Award for lifetime achievement.

Cabello was contending with rapper Drake and singer Childish Gambino.

During her speech, the former Fifth Harmony singer gave a “shoutout to all the amazing female artists this year”, reported theguardian.com.

The gala was kicked off by rapper Cardi B appearing onstage announcing herself to be “the empress” before introducing a performance by singer Shawn Mendes.

It was a muted start for the VMAs following on from last year’s politically charged opener from rapper Kendrick Lamar.

Cardi B picked up awards for best collaboration with Jennifer Lopez and DJ Khaled, and best new artist.

“A couple of months ago people were saying you were gambling your career by having a baby,” she said.

Singer Madonna, who was wearing traditional African clothing, paid a tribute to the “Queen of Soul” Aretha Franklin, who died on August 16. The ceremony did not include a much-expected musical homage, but instead Madonna came onstage to share a story about how singing “You Make Me Feel (Like a Natural Woman)” at an audition changed her life.

But her tribute to the late star proved unpopular with many.

The full list of 2018 MTV VMA winners are:

  • Video of the Year: Camila Cabello – ‘Havana’
  • Artist of the Year: Camila Cabello
  • Best Hip Hop Video: Nicki Minaj – ‘Chun Li’
  • Best Pop Video: Ariana Grande – ‘No Tears Left To Cry’
  • Song of the Year: Post Malone ft. 21 Savage – ‘Rockstar’
  • Best Latin Video: J Balvin ft. Willy William – ‘Mi Gente’
  • Video Vanguard Award: Jennifer Lopez
  • Best New Artist: Cardi B
  • Best Collaboration: Jennifer Lopez, DJ Khalid, and Cardi B – ‘Dinero’
  • Video with a Message: Childish Gambino – ‘This Is America’
  • Best Rock Video: Imagine Dragons – ‘Whatever It Takes’
  • Best Cinematography: The Carters – ‘APES**T’
  • Best Direction: Childish Gambino – ‘This Is America’
  • Best Visual Effects: Kendrick Lamar and SZA – ‘All The Stars’
  • Best Choreography: Childish Gambino – ‘This Is America’
  • Best Editing:E.R.D ft. Rihanna – ‘Lemon’
  • Push Artist of the Year: Hayley Kiyoko
  • Song of Summer: Cardi B, Bad Bunny & J Balvin – ‘I Like It’
